WAYS OF EXPRESSING FUTURE 


1. Future with ''will'' - actiuni spontane (I will let you know as soon as I find out. )

2. ''Be going to'' = a intentiona sa = The government is going to close schools when the number of cases will be more than six in one thousand.

3.  Present simple - actiuni viitoare care fac parte dintr-un program oficial (The train leaves at 10:30.)

4. Present continuous- actiuni viitoare care fac parte dintr-un plan personal (My mom is buying a cake for her birthday next week. )

C) Rewrite the following sentences without changing the meaning:

 

     Example: There wasn’t anyone in front of me in the cinema.

                       There was no one in front of me in the cinema.

 

1.     They don’t know anyone in this town.

They know no one/ nobody in this town.

2.     She met no one at the bus stop.

She didn’t meet anyone/ anybody at the bus stop.

3.     You told nobody to go with you.

You didn't tell anyone/ anybody to go with you.

4.     We ate nothing until dinner.

We didn’t eat anything until dinner.

5.     She told no one nothing about last night.

She didn’t tell anyone/ anybody about last night.

6.     She didn’t tell anybody about her plans.

She told no one/ nobody about her plans.

7.     I didn’t say anything.

I said nothing.

8.     The station isn’t anywhere near here.

The station is nowhere near here.

9.     I don’t want anything to drink.

I want nothing to drink. 

10.  We did nothing during our vacation.

We didn't do anything during our vacation.

A FEW/ FEW ; A LITTLE/ LITTLE  


A FEW= CATEVA ( DESTULE)

FEW = CATEVA ( NU DE AJUNS) 


A LITTLE = PUTIN ( DESTUL)

LITTLE= PUTIN ( NU DE AJUNS)
